# Matchstone Environments

Quick refresher for the sync: Matchstone (our pairing/matching service) runs in three environments — dev on the Calloway minis, staging on Harrowfen, prod on the big Veldergrove nodes. The GC pause saga mostly bites prod, where old-gen collections were stalling match windows by up to 900ms. Anil's tuning pass on the staging heap looked promising, so we promoted it last week. Each environment now runs with the following collector settings.

deployment values, tahag-fajof:
[drudor]
port = 6379
region = outer-3
host = drudor.zarqelhq.internal
team = fraox
timeout_ms = 3000
retries = 7

Subject: DR drill next Tuesday — export retry path

Hi support team,

Next Tuesday we're running a disaster-recovery drill on Parcelwick's export pipeline. We'll intentionally fail a batch of report exports, then exercise the automatic retry path. Expect test tickets tagged DRILL in the queue; please triage them normally but don't escalate. Retries should clear within fifteen minutes.

If a drill export stays stuck, you'll need access to the recovery dashboard, which opens with the passphrase below.

unlock words, bahop-fawef: novmir-druwyn-soriel-rusdor-kasion

This page documents provenance for the autocomplete index shipped with the Harrowfield search service. The index is built nightly on the Coldbrook builder pool; slow builds observed last quarter traced to an unsigned tokenizer stage, which has since been moved inside the attested pipeline. Reviewers should confirm that every index artifact chains back to a signed builder manifest and that the tokenizer hash matches the recorded digest. The current attested index build is identified by the token that follows.

build token for kagaf-hahof: htk14_9d3d4d26d7d8de